Sans Contrasted Abke 11 is a light, normal width, high contrast, upright, normal x-height font.

This typeface presents a clean, sharply drawn skeleton with pronounced thick–thin modulation and crisp, tapered terminals. Curves are smooth and open, while joins and vertexes feel cut and precise, giving many letters a slightly chiselled look. Proportions are balanced with a moderate x-height, relatively narrow apertures in places, and a steady vertical rhythm that reads polished in both uppercase and lowercase. The numerals follow the same contrasting logic, with fine hairlines and heavier stems creating a lively texture at display sizes.

This font is best suited to display and large text applications such as magazine headlines, deck copy, pull quotes, and brand wordmarks where its contrast and precision can be appreciated. It can also work for short subheads and curated packaging text, particularly in layouts that favor white space and a refined typographic palette.

The overall tone is poised and cultivated, with a modern editorial sensibility. Its high-contrast drawing and sharp finishing details evoke luxury, fashion, and cultural publishing, conveying confidence without feeling ornamental.

The letterforms appear designed to deliver a contemporary, high-end voice by combining a restrained, clean structure with dramatic stroke modulation and sharp terminal treatments. The intent seems focused on producing an elegant typographic color for editorial and branding contexts while maintaining a straightforward, upright stance.

The design relies on thin hairlines and slender cross-strokes, so spacing and internal counters play a prominent role in its legibility and color. In longer settings it produces a bright, shimmering texture; in headlines it feels especially crisp and commanding.
